/**
 * Configure the width and height elements on `tabname` to accept
 * pasting of resolutions in the form of "width x height".
 */
function setupResolutionPasting(tabname) {
    var width = gradioApp().querySelector(`#${tabname}_width input[type=number]`);
    var height = gradioApp().querySelector(`#${tabname}_height input[type=number]`);
    for (const el of [width, height]) {
        el.addEventListener('paste', function(event) {
            var pasteData = event.clipboardData.getData('text/plain');
            var parsed = pasteData.match(/^\s*(\d+)\D+(\d+)\s*$/);
            if (parsed) {
                width.value = parsed[1];
                height.value = parsed[2];
                updateInput(width);
                updateInput(height);
                event.preventDefault();
            }
        });
    }
}
